Output e6a4039ab15e0972df07c84cef74d1d76c5ab798eedc2880acbcefa9587823a4:56

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6944fbebde059c511f2a9cac2fcc21b50d8f062f87801db9ca273c70781e97b1
address
bc1pd9z0h677qkw9z8e2njkzlnppk5xc7p30s7qpmww2yu78q7q7j7cskhq7a0
transaction
e6a4039ab15e0972df07c84cef74d1d76c5ab798eedc2880acbcefa9587823a4
spent
true